Transaction e8fba951421eeef8d1e0b9866227673b052ef8b0ff023b12551d11ba8c37759d
1 Input
1 Output
-
e8fba951421eeef8d1e0b9866227673b052ef8b0ff023b12551d11ba8c37759d:0
- value
- 30564
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54a2bd47c290d643f3c7ef2545b2a50f4a579e06 OP_EQUAL
- address
- 39QXdzEYDFqZJrG77111ao4bpXZ16NwraW